What is ISO 15392 - Sustainability in buildings and civil engineering works about?  

This international standard discusses construction technology and aims to assist its users in constructing eco-friendly and better-quality building structures.  

ISO 15392 identifies and establishes general principles for the contribution of buildings, civil engineering works and other types of construction works (hereinafter referred to collectively as construction works) to sustainable development.  

ISO 15392 is based on the concept of sustainable development as it applies to the life cycle of construction works, from inception to the end of life. ISO 15392 is applicable to new and existing construction works, individually and collectively, as well as to the materials, products, services and processes related to their life cycle.  

Note1: The principles established in ISO 15392 are intended to be applied broadly in the context of construction works. Specific applications are the subject of other related documents. 

Note2: In ISO 15392, unless explicitly stated, the term ‘product(s)’ implies construction product and the term ‘service(s)’ implies construction service. 

Note3: ISO 15392 is not intended to provide the basis for assessment of organizations or other stakeholders, but does acknowledge the importance of their role in the context of contributions to sustainable development by buildings, civil engineering works and other construction works

Note4: ISO 15392 does not provide performance levels (benchmarks) that can serve as the basis for sustainability claims.

What’s changed since the last update? 

BS ISO 15392:2019 replaces ISO 15392:2008, which has been technically revised. The main changes in BS ISO 15392:2019 compared to ISO 15392:2008 are as follows: 

  • The title and scope of the document have been updated to reflect that it applies to both buildings and civil engineering works 
  • This scope of the document has been clarified to state that it identifies and establishes general principles for the contribution of buildings, civil engineering works and other types of construction works to sustainable development 
  • The list of objectives for applying the concepts to sustainability and promoting sustainable development has been expanded to include additional considerations 
  • The list of nine general principles has been updated to continual improvement, equity, global thinking and local action, holistic approach, involvement of interested parties, long-term consideration and resilience, responsibility, risk management, and transparency 
  • A description and additional explanatory information has been added for each principle 
  • The concept of resilience was added as a key consideration as part of the principle of long-term consideration
